Recent research in the field of radiotherapy has brought up a wide variety of new techniques, which have a big impact on the clinical practice of radiotherapy. This electronic book gives an indepth description of new techniques and their physical principles as well as an overview over new technical developments. Topics covered with this CD include such innovative subjects as: - Intensity Modulated Radiation Therapy - Inverse Planning - Monte Carlo Techniques - Video Documentation of new Radiotherapy Procedures. Using sophisticated multimedia techniques gives you not only a comprehensive but also easy to understand description of state of the art radiotherapy techniques which will help you to stay up to date with the cutting edge of current research.

Author: Schlegel, Wolfgang
Prof. Dr. Wolfgang Schlegel studied Physics at the Free University of Berlin and the University of Heidelberg. He is the head of the Medical Physics department at the German Cancer Research Center (dkfz) in Heidelberg and Professor for Medical Physics at the University of Heidelberg. Prof. Thomas Bortfeld studied Physics at the Universities of Hannover and Heidelberg. He received his training in Medical Physics at the DKFZ in Heidelberg. He is now the Director of Physics Research in Radiation Oncology at the Massachusetts General Hospital in Boston, and Associate Professor at Harvard Medical School. Dr. Anca-Ligia Grosu studied medicine in Cluj (Romania) and received her MD in Radiation Oncology at the Technical University of Munich. She is the Head of the Brain Stereotactical Radiotherapy and Radiosurgery Group of the Department of Radiation Oncology at the Technical University and the Vice-President of the Neuro-Oncology-Group at the Tumour Center in Munich.
